Work on Fia's Model
Shortly after finishing Fauna's animation I started working on Fia's model to use in the final versions of Dream Molder.For everyone wondering what the whole model thing is about it's pretty much the main graphic file used to display Fia throughout the game, build in/with Live2D and gives me the ability to animate her sprites.
Since Fia has a bit over 100 expressions and poses there's quite a lot to consider until the model is 100% finished, but once the it's done there's not much left towards the proper releases, with CG-Art being the only thing left to do.
Work on the model was going well and I was expecting to be done with it around now as animations, the ability to change her colors, style, etc was all working fine already.
Technical Difficulties
Knowing that there's not much more to be done to finish it I put it aside to work on the Lucario animations for the month.
When I came back to implement the model into the game however it didn't work out as much as I was hoping for...
The model appeared much lower quality from it should actually be like.
Outlines were fuzzy and some things were missing completely.
Experimenting with the model a bit made it obvious that the problem wasn't the model itself but the engine messing up some of the color layers which made the model appear fuzzy.
You can see how the model in itself is actually quite clear when I dye her fur white which removes all the color layers.
Not really knowing what causes this I had to look into the engines code, rework parts of the model and try to figure out what the problem was in general.
I actually went so far as to rebuild the whole model from scratch but to no avail.
The latest build did improve the quality somewhat to not make it obvious as quickly, that definitely wasn't enough to use it for the game though.
You can see how the model in itself is actually quite clear when I dye her fur white which removes all the color layers.
Not really knowing what causes this I had to look into the engines code, rework parts of the model and try to figure out what the problem was in general.
I actually went so far as to rebuild the whole model from scratch but to no avail.
The latest build did improve the quality somewhat to not make it obvious as quickly, that definitely wasn't enough to use it for the game though.
The mode actually looks fine when viewed in preview or with any other software, putting it in the game though somehow messes up the colors.
The time it took to come to this conclusion however took way too long and I've wasted a lot of time trying to rework the model to make it work and right now I've got about 3 ways to move forward.
1.: Find whatever causes this in the engines code, change it and use the same model
2.: Rework the model to not dye it in real time and have a limited amount of colors to choose from instead
3.: Use another engine or write one from scratch and transfer everything made so far over time.
The first one I go for will definitely be 1. as this one has the highest chances of keeping everything done so far. The engine seems to mess with clipping layers for some reason, most likely scaling them weirdly?

CG Variations
CG variations will be a big part of the game.
While a CG-Image is a full screen image that shows a scene in more detail, a variation of it will slightly alter the image to go along with the story.
This can be simple things like changing a facial expression, but it can also have some more extreme changes like a different pose or background.
All in all however, it's still the same base-image that's simply been changed.
That's why you see a lot of CGxxx-1, CGxxx-2 etc in the latest demo.
Variations will help make the game feel more alive and hopefully almost cinematic.
In H-scenes the variations will have an additional use and represent something similear to "key-frames" that will be needed for animations later on.
Every variation pretty much shows me what kind of body parts I need to draw in which angle and at which time of the animation it's used.
Here's a little example of how they're put together to make it easy to replace parts and make it easier to model the animation later on.
Image: Sketch/Variation layer example from office scene (Spoiler!)
For now it's just a few parts layered over each other, swapped out for each variation sketch.
